I met two error with the same design today, I wonder if they are linked?

(Error 1) I built a ship on the 5 deck hull and I have an elevator (Lift 1) going from deck 4 to 5 (the top deck is 5 for this text) and another one (Lift 2) going all the way from deck 1 to 4. I exported the ship, all is fine and doing well and I tried it and then wanted to change the design. When loading the design it tells me there is an error with an unknown room.

(Error 2) Then I tried another crew management mission with the ship, and at some point I run in the error that a lift is wrong somewhere. I noticed that while preparing my TEC patrols, one of them was saying it would use Lift 1 in its patrol design (the red line) to go down from Deck 4 to 3 and Lift 2 to come back up.

Could there be a link between the 2 error and a bug with lifts where they try to use one to go down though it does not? Thus saying there is an unknown lift and a wrong room placement?

Following is the error code and my ship design.

Error 1 :
Code:
___________________________________________
ERROR in
action number 1
of Collision Event with object obj_mark_links_oben
for object obj_mark_links_unten:

Error in code at line 3:
      if other.master.room_type = t_corr
                      ^
at position 21: Unknown variable room_type


Error 2:
Code:
___________________________________________
ERROR in
action number 1
of  Step Event
for object obj_unit:

In script activate_lift:
Error in code at line 18:
          if aktueller_raum.stairway = false
                            ^
at position 27: Unknown variable stairway

I had similar issue
(been playing through wine, which btw, works pretty fine, but naturally i would prefer a native linux version)

It came to such end that i couldn't play any crew management, w/o a lift (error 2)

and when suddenly i couldn't open my project at all w/o an (error 1) crashing it I tried modifying the the prj file
by comparing how an empty project with a lift was saved to my "complete" one

anyhow
object of name=148 got a connection to an object of type name=153
(while in the empty project it is connected to itself), so after changing that, the prj file loaded (as it should?)
As well, I managed to actually finish a crew management mission w/o incident but it did however still report (error 2) after the mission was finished, so maybe it was still a matter of time,
I suspect this is an issue from moving a lift around in the the design phase
